Your Role
We are currently seeking a mechanic for our unique production of state-of-the-art submarines and surface vessels at one of the world's most modern shipyards.
In your role as a mechanic, your primary responsibilities will focus on the manufacturing and assembly of mechanical installations within the new construction of surface vessels. As a mechanic, you will work in areas such as propulsion, valve/pump, rudder assembly, and leak testing. Saab is a leading defense and security company with a mission to help nations protect their populations and contribute to the safety of people and communities. With 22,000 talented employees, Saab develops technology and solutions for a safer and more sustainable world.
Saab develops, manufactures, and maintains advanced systems in aerospace, weapons, command systems, sensors, and underwater systems. Saab is headquartered in Sweden but has a global presence, being part of many nations' defense capabilities. Read more about us here.
